After independence from Malaysia in 1965, immigration laws were modified in 1966 to reinforce Singapore's identity as a sovereign state. However, the initial strict controls on immigrant workers were relaxed as demand for labour grew with increased industrialisation. The Ministry of Manpower (MoM) has a semi flexible law for immigration that starts with procuring an employment pass (EP).
